Optimizing Engraftment of Gastric Cancer Patient-derived Xenograft Models and Monitoring with MRI

<title>Abstract</title> <p> Gastric cancer (GC) Patient-derived xenograft PDX models have low engraftment rates (12–15%). This study aims to examine the critical factors and evaluation approaches in GC PDX models. Tumor tissues from 33 GC patients were transplanted into NOD/SCID mice.
